MARK CUBAN EXPOSES PBM SCAM COSTING PATIENTS BILLIONS BEFORE SENATE

Mark Cuban just testified before the Senate explaining how Pharmacy Benefit Managers are a bigger monopoly than Amazon, controlling drug access for 270 million Americans while driving prices up, not down:

“PBMs auction off access to their formularies to the highest bidders.

Drug companies pay rebates and fees so their drugs can be covered.

The higher the list price, the more money PBMs make.”

A $600 drug costs the manufacturer $240 after rebates.

Uninsured patients pay $600. Insured patients with deductibles also pay $600.

The PBM pockets the difference.

Cuban’s solution: count cash payments toward deductibles, base out-of-pocket costs on net price, separate formularies from PBMs, and end specialty tiers.
